How to fill out briefly describe form organizations

How to fill out the briefly describe form organizations:
01
Start by carefully reading the instructions provided on the form. Understand the specific information that needs to be included in the description of the organization.
02
Begin by providing basic details such as the name of the organization, its legal structure, and the year it was established. You may also need to indicate the organization's registration number, if applicable.
03
Describe the purpose or mission of the organization. Highlight the main activities or services it offers and the target audience it serves. Be concise but clear in explaining the organization's core functions.
04
Include any notable achievements, awards, or recognition received by the organization. This could involve mentioning successful projects, partnerships, or initiatives that have had a significant impact.
05
Provide information on the organization's leadership structure. This may include the names and roles of key personnel, such as the CEO, board members, or directors.
06
Mention any affiliations or partnerships the organization has with other entities, such as government agencies, non-profit organizations, or industry associations.
07
If necessary, include a brief history of the organization, detailing its growth, major milestones, and significant events that have shaped its development.
08
Finally, proofread the description to ensure accuracy, clarity, and adherence to any word or character limits specified on the form.
